Description |
Habitat: Sunny areas along roadsides, woodland openings. Plant: Erect, very hairy perennial, 1 to 3 ft high, colony-forming. Leaves: Sessile, lanceolate, hairy, deeply veined, up to 4 inches long and 3/4-inch wide. Inflorescence: White blossoms about 3/4-inch long in drooping clusters. Bloom Period: April to May.
